Great Barrier Reef named the best place in the world to visit

- newsfirst.lk

In a much-needed boost for the Great Barrier Reef, the world’s largest living organism has been voted the best place in the world to visit by an influential US travel site.

US News and World Report’s World’s Best Places to Visit for 2016-17 ranked the Reef No.1 ahead of Paris and Bora Bora in French Polynesia.

The Great Barrier Reef is facing rising sea temperatures that have led to mass coral bleaching, Australian scientists say.

The reef covers an area of 344,400 square kilometers and includes about 600 continental islands, 3,000 coral reefs and 150 inshore mangrove islands.

U.S. News analyzed more than 250 destinations using a methodology that combines expert analysis and traveler opinions.
